Fire Extinguishers Test (true or false) 53. Never play with the extinguishers so they will remain charged for
emergencies.
54. Before you use an extinguisher check what kind it is.
55. Class A - wood, paper, trash, etc...
56. Class B - flammable liquids such as paints and finishes.
57. Class C - electrical fires.
58. ABC extinguishers should be safe for all type fires.
59. Water on flammable liquids will spread the fire since it floats on the water.
60. Water on electrical is a shocking choice.
